classic white bread

betty crockers

6-7 cups flour
3 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oon salt
2 tablespoons shortening
4, 1/2 teaspoons yeast
2, 1/4 cups very warm water

3, 1/2 cups flour, solid ingredients, liquid ingredients
add flour 1 cup at a time
knead dough, let rest for 1 hour
grease pans, add dough
grease dough to make it good and crunchy
let dough rise for 1 hour
oven 425 degrees f
bake 25-30 minutes

very sweet corn bread

betty crockers

1 cup milk
1/4 cup melted butter
1 egg
1, 1/4 cups cornmeal
1 cup flour
1/2 cup sugar
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t

oven 400 degrees f
liquid, then solid
grease pan
bake 20-25 minutes

chickpea curry

my mom

2 cans chickpeas (30 oz)
1 cilantro
1 lime
3 cloves minced garlic
ginger
1 minced onion
1 can crushed tomatoes (15 oz)
1 can coconut milk (13.5 oz)
vegetable stock
2 tablespoons vegetable or coconut oil
1 tablespoon curry powder
turmeric powder
1 teaspoon cumin
coriander
1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es
black pepper
salt

sautee onion, add garlic and ginger
change heat to low and add spices
add chickpeas, stock, tomatoes, coconut milk
let simmer and stir 20 minutes
blend till smooth

Easy Fettuchine Alfredo

culinary class

Noodles
salt
6 tablespoons fresh grated parmesan cheese
5 tablespoons butter

melt butter in a saucepan and turn off heat
boil pasta wih some salt
set 1 cup of pasta water aside
add pasta to the butter
add 1/3 cup pasta water and cheese and stir

sourdough crackers

culinary class

1 cup sourdough starter
1 cup flour
1/2 teaspoon flaky sea salt (VERY IMPORTANT)
4 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ons dried herbs (i used oregano)
oil

mix the first 5 ingredients
refrigerate for 30 minutes or more
oven 350 degrees f
roll out dough, apply oil and additional salt
cut dough into small squares and poke holes with fork
bake for 20-25 minutes

my beloved chocolate graham cracker pie

my mom

Crust: 20 squares of graham crackers
1/3 cup of butter
3 tablespoons sugar

oven 350 degrees f
crush graham crackers
combine all ingredients
press into pie pan
bake 10 minutes

Filling: 1/2 cup cocoa powder
1/4 cup cornstarch
3 egg yolks
1, 1/2 cups s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 cups milk
1 teaspoon vanilla

saucepan, medium-high heat
add ingredients in order
cook until thick 10-15 minutes
pour into pie crust and refrigerate

split seconds (shortbread cookies)

culinary class

2 cups flour
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
2/3 cup sugar
3/4 cup butter
1 beaten egg
2 teaspoons vanilla
1/3 cup red jelly
powdered sugar

oven 350 degrees f
solid, then liquid
divide dough into 4 parts
roll dough into snakes
press a long deep ditch along the top of the snakes
stir jelly and fill ditch with it
bake 15-20 minutes
cut and sprinkle with powdered sugar

fortune cookies

culinary class

2 egg whites
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
3 tablespoons vegetable oil
8 tablespoons flour
1, 1/2 teaspoons c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on salt
8 tablespooons sugar
3 teaspoons water
fortunes :>

oven 300 degrees f
liquid, except for water, then solid then water
spoon batter onto baking sheet and spread it very thin
bake 14-15 minutes
fold fortune into hot cookie, and fold over again
